JavaScript game development: Unterschied zwischen den Versionen
aus Metalab Wiki, dem offenen Zentrum für meta-disziplinäre Magier und technisch-kreative Enthusiasten.
Zur Navigation springenZur Suche springen
Lfittl (Diskussion | Beiträge) Keine Bearbeitungszusammenfassung |
C3o (Diskussion | Beiträge) |
||
Zeile 25: | Zeile 25: | ||
== Projects & Ideas == | == Projects & Ideas == | ||
* JShmup ([[user:c3o|c3o]]) | |||
: Full window shoot em up as browser stress test | |||
: Prototype exists (flying+shooting) | |||
* JS Spryjinx ([[user:c3o|c3o]]) | * JS Spryjinx ([[user:c3o|c3o]]) | ||
: Prototype exists | : Remake of simple DOS 2 player platform game | ||
: Prototype exists (basic game elements, 2 player controls, game over) | |||
* AjaxGo ([[user:c3o|c3o]], [[user:lfittl|lfittl]]) | * AjaxGo ([[user:c3o|c3o]], [[user:lfittl|lfittl]]) | ||
: | : Multiplayer online Go | ||
: Idea only | |||
== Interested parties == | == Interested parties == |
Version vom 10. September 2007, 03:19 Uhr
Why would anyone do that? Because on two recent cool devices, JavaScript is the ONLY option for open, unrestricted application development. Because making games in JS is a hack and a challenge. Because few people have pushed the technology to its performance limits yet. And because we can.
[This page is in English because its subject is not limited to the Metalab]
Platforms
- Wii!
- iPhone!
- Regular old boring computers
Technologies
- DHTML/DOM animation
- Canvas (Opera: 2dgame context)
- Wii Remote API & Events Library
- Moz Tech: XUL, XBL etc... no real justification for those though.
- Upcoming canvas 3d context
What to do
- Start a wiki?
- Build a library? Input handling, sprite animation, collision detection, SFX, etc etc. Needs more research.
- Organize a competition like PyWeek
Projects & Ideas
- JShmup (c3o)
- Full window shoot em up as browser stress test
- Prototype exists (flying+shooting)
- JS Spryjinx (c3o)
- Remake of simple DOS 2 player platform game
- Prototype exists (basic game elements, 2 player controls, game over)
- Multiplayer online Go
- Idea only
Interested parties
References
- iPhone Dev Camp Germany (date unannounced)
- JavaScriptGamer.com Arkanoid tutorial (uses Prototype)
Notable games
Multiplayer
Single player
iPhone
Experimental
- Canvex FPS
- Moon lander
Lists/indexes